Job Title: Food Program Co-Op
Reports to: Youth & Family Director
Status: Part-Time (approx. 15 hours per week)
Schedule: 3:00PM-6:30PM, M-F
Compensation: $12.50 per hour and FREE YMCA Membership
POSITION SUMMARY:
This position supports the work of the Y, a leading nonprofit committed to strengthening community through youth development, healthy living and social responsibility. Food Program Staff will be responsible for assisting the Youth & Family Director in the administration of all meal and snack programs.
JOB DETAILS AND 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
- Prepare and serve food according to appropriate food safety requirements.
- Responsible for ensuring all CACFP and SFSP required records are completed accurately and on time in accordance with program requirements.
- Build and maintain positive relationships with staff, volunteers, children and families served, and partner organizations in the community.
- Be proactive in the ongoing recruitment of program participants and education/outreach of YMCA anti-hunger initiatives for the community.
- Attend all required staff trainings and meetings.
- Serve as a role model always representing the YMCA with a professional demeanor.
- Help with other tasks as assigned by supervisor.
QUALIFICATIONS:
- Must be a high school student eligible for Work Based Learning Program
- Prior food service experience preferred
- ServSafe Certification preferred
- CPR and First Aid Certifications preferred
- Demonstrate a desire to serve others and fulfill community needs
- Previous experience with diverse populations and ability to develop positive, authentic relationships with children and families from diverse backgrounds
- Reliable transportation required as some program serving locations are offsite
- Able to lift up to 20lbs
